Darba 40mcg Injection Patient Guide

Overview

Darba 40mcg Injection, manufactured by RPG Life Sciences Ltd, contains Darbepoetin alfa (40mcg) as its active ingredient. This medication is designed to help increase red blood cell production in the body, which can be beneficial for individuals with certain health conditions. As a patient, it's essential to understand how Darba works, its uses, and potential side effects.

Uses

Darba 40mcg Injection is used to treat anemia in patients with chronic kidney disease, HIV infection, or cancer. It helps increase red blood cell production, reducing the need for blood transfusions. Darba is also used to treat anemia associated with chemotherapy.

Mechanism of Action

Darba 40mcg Injection works by stimulating the production of red blood cells in the bone marrow. It does this by binding to the erythropoietin receptor, which is responsible for regulating red blood cell production. By mimicking the action of erythropoietin, Darba helps increase the production of red blood cells, which can help alleviate anemia symptoms.

Side Effects

Common side effects of Darba 40mcg Injection may include:

  • Headache
  • Fatigue
  • Dizziness
  • Nausea
  • Vomiting
  • Muscle pain
  • Joint pain

More severe side effects can occur, such as:

  • Allergic reactions (e.g., hives, itching, swelling)
  • Increased blood pressure
  • Blood clots
  • Stroke

If you experience any of these side effects, contact your doctor immediately.

Precautions

Before taking Darba 40mcg Injection, inform your doctor about any of the following:

  • Allergies to Darbepoetin alfa or other medications
  • Pregnancy or breastfeeding
  • History of blood clots or stroke
  • Kidney or liver disease
  • Cancer
